JEFFERSON COUNTY – Drivers who use northbound Interstate 55 between Route Z and Route M should be aware the interstate will close overnight next week for bridge construction.
Weather permitting, crews will close all lanes of northbound I-55 nightly from Tuesday, December 9 through Saturday, December 13 between 11 p.m. and 4 a.m. to set girders for a new bridge over the BNSF railroad.
A signed detour will direct traffic around the closure. Drivers will exit I-55 at Route Z (Exit 180) and turn right. They’ll then turn left at U.S. Route 61/67 and continue along that route until they reach Route M, where they will turn left, and then take the ramp on the right side of Route M to re-enter northbound I-55.
